Can Chihuahuas Cure Asthma?

Explaining an Old Folk Remedy

The belief that a Chihuahua can "take away" asthma from its owner is still held by some, however medical experts reject the idea that the folk remedy can cure asthma.

For many years, the idea that Chihuahuas can cure asthma has been passed around. Citing personal experience or hearsay from someone else, supporters of this idea believe that the toy breed dog really can take away asthma from its owner. They may claim that the dog should sleep on the chest of the asthmatic person to somehow take in the asthma itself.

Short-haired Chihuahuas may be considered somewhat more hypoallergenic than many dog breeds but the scientific and medical community regards the loss of asthma symptoms in the presence of a Chihuahua as purely coincidental or psychosomatic. In fact, in some cases, some dogs and other pets may even bring on asthma symptoms such as shortness of breath and wheezing.

Origin of Chihuahua as an Asthma Cure

The origin of this folk remedy is not clear but several theories can be considered. Although asthma treatment includes medications and other measures, at present, the medical world has no cure for the respiratory disease. The majority of asthma cases are successfully managed but some severe asthmatics, in their search for relief, may be willing to accept, and pass on, unorthodox ideas. At any rate, the folk remedy has been around for many years.

One rumor has it that the superstition may be somehow connected with the Aztecs. In history, Chihuahuas were quite popular with the Aztecs who held the belief that the dog would take on the sins of a dead person and guide him through death to afterlife.

Perhaps seeming to add support to the asthma-cure belief, Chihuahuas sometimes have respiratory problems and may make wheezing sounds similar to asthmatics. Since asthma seems to be most prevalent in children who often lose their asthma symptoms as they mature, it may be easy for some to conclude that the coincidental Chihuahua in the household “took away” the asthma from the child.

Another theory may be that acquiring a faithful companion like the Chihuahua may ease stress and tension in the life of the asthma sufferer which in some cases may relieve asthma symptoms. Dogs and other pets have certainly been proven to lower blood pressure and hasten healing in some illnesses.

Managing Asthma

While a Chihuahua can be a good choice as a pet and loyal friend, the best choice of asthma treatment, according to the Mayo Clinic, is under the care of a physician, generally with long-term control medications, quick-relief medications, possible allergy treatment, and avoidance of bronchial inflammation triggers.
